bent in iphone 6 plus

i have purchased my iphone 6plus from USA and i am residing currently in india, there is a bent in my iphone near volume buttons , how can i get my phone replaced or fixed in india ,

The warranty on an iPhone is valid only in the country where it was originally purchased. You will want to contact Apple in the USA and see if they offer anything for you to ship it back to the US and have it diagnosed. Just be aware that when the iPhone 6 Plus came out there were a lot of people claiming their iPhones were getting bent and Apple was looking at each of those on a case-by-case basis. Since then it has been determined that quite a bit of force needs to be applied for an iPhone to bend. Independent testing shows that 90 pounds of force needs to be applied to get an iPhone 6 Plus to bend. Therefore, even if you are able to send it back to the USA for diagnosing, it may get returned to you stating that physical damage is not covered by the warranty.
